Overview
The Zebra KT-HSX100-MWS1-50 is a consumable accessory pack containing 50 replacement microphone windsocks engineered for Zebra HSX100 series headsets. These foam windsocks fit directly over the microphone capsule to suppress wind noise and environmental acoustic interference — a critical factor in high-noise warehouse, logistics, and outdoor voice-picking environments where audio clarity directly affects operator productivity and compliance with voice-directed picking systems.
Windsocks are often overlooked consumables, but they wear out or degrade faster than the headset itself, especially in dusty or high-humidity distribution centers. Maintaining a stock of replacement windsocks ensures consistent audio quality without requiring full headset replacement. Key Features & Deployment Benefits
- Wind and Environmental Noise Suppression: Windsocks absorb turbulent air movement and reduce plosive (p, b, t) artifacts that corrupt microphone input during high-velocity air events — common in outdoor loading docks, conveyor areas, or near dock doors. Better audio input means fewer voice command misrecognitions, reducing pick errors and retry cycles.
- Microphone Lifespan Extension: Foam windsocks act as a sacrificial barrier, protecting the microphone capsule from direct exposure to dust, moisture vapor, and abrasive airborne particles. Replacing a worn windsock ($0.20–0.50 per unit in bulk) is vastly cheaper than replacing a $50–100+ headset due to microphone degradation.

Frequently Asked Questions
Q: How often should I replace windsocks on HSX100 headsets?
A: Replacement frequency depends on deployment environment and usage intensity. In dusty warehouse settings, windsocks may degrade or become saturated with particles within 3–6 months. In cleaner indoor environments, 12 months is typical. When you notice reduced audio quality, picking errors increasing, or visible foam deterioration, it's time to replace.
Q: Are these windsocks compatible with older Zebra headset models?
A: The KT-HSX100-MWS1-50 is engineered specifically for the HSX100 series. Do not assume compatibility with other Zebra headset lines without verifying the part number on your current headset. Incorrect sizing will result in a poor acoustic seal and loss of noise suppression.
Q: Can I wash or clean windsocks instead of replacing them?
A: Foam windsocks are not designed for washing or dry cleaning. Once saturated with dust, moisture, or contaminants, the foam's acoustic and physical properties degrade. Replacement is the correct maintenance approach. At bulk pricing, replacement is cost-effective compared to headset downtime.
Q: What's the shelf life of unused windsocks?
A: Foam windsocks stored in a cool, dry environment are stable for 2+ years. Avoid prolonged exposure to direct sunlight, extreme heat (above 90°F), or high humidity, which can degrade foam integrity over time. Keep the 50-pack sealed until deployment.
